About JAMA-AT-UL ISLAMIYYA OF NIGERIA (UK)

JAMA-AT-UL ISLAMIYYA OF NIGERIA (UK) is a registered charity in England and Wales (registration number 1084862). Based on official Charity Commission data, it holds a "Verified" rating with a CharityScore of 80/100 — a well-rated and transparent charity that meets strong governance standards. This indicates a reliable charity with strong fundamentals across most of our assessment criteria. In its most recent reporting year (2024), JAMA-AT-UL ISLAMIYYA OF NIGERIA (UK) reported a total income of £152,627 and total expenditure of £83,029, a spending ratio of 54% suggesting a reasonable but not exceptional allocation to charitable activities. According to the Charity Commission register, JAMA-AT-UL ISLAMIYYA OF NIGERIA (UK) describes its activities as follows: The principal activities of the charity include: weekend and end of months prayer meetings, weekend classes for adults and children, monthly youth activities, yearly Eid prayers and celebrations, annual family outings/trips and regular advice and advocacy as necessary. Visiting sick people at home and in hospital. conducting naming and wedding ceremonies, and funeral service and prayers. Our analysis has identified 1 high-severity concern for this charity.
